      • The Main Page, known as HomePage from 15 January 2001 to 25 January 2002, [a] has been the dominant page on Wikipedia since its inception. The first page to be created, on any given day it is by far the most viewed page on the website, with more than 23 million daily views as of 2016.

    The Wikipedia home page on December 20, 2001. Wikipedia gained early contributors from Nupedia, Slashdot postings, and web search engine indexing. Language editions were created beginning in March 2001, with a total of 161 in use by the end of 2004.

  7. Wikipedia was started on January 9, 2001, by Jimmy Wales and Larry Sanger as part of an earlier online encyclopedia named Nupedia. On January 15, 2001, Wikipedia became a separate website of its own. It is a wiki that uses the software MediaWiki (like all other Wikimedia Foundation projects).
